The Good News: TriQuint Semiconductor is considering opening a new facility in north High Point. It could bring as many as 25 high paying jobs and the city offered $25,000 in incentives for TriQuint to come.
The Bad News: City officials are asking for a property tax increase of a penny and a half per $100 to balance the proposed $273 million budget. Strib Boynton blames rising energy costs for the need to raise taxes.
